The Greatest Gift

A Poem; Selection I, Of The Curation

Photo by Miriam G on Unsplash

Sometimes love

Is a small whispering bell

Residing quietly within,

At others, it is a clamoring,

Resounding force which

Shakes you to your core

Calling your heart to hope,

Hang love high

In the tower of your soul,

Ring it loud, ring it often;

Let it call you again and again.

Guard closely the love within you.

If you do not listen –

If you turn away –

From the greatest gift,

You become as thin as air.
